Chapter 501 - CLOSED COOPERATIVES
Section 501.101 - Definitions.

Universal Citation: IA Code § 501.101 (2018)

501.101

Definitions.

As used in this chapter, unless the context requires otherwise:

1. “Alternative voting method” means a method of voting other than a written ballot, including voting by electronic, telephonic, internet, or other means that reasonably allows members the opportunity to vote.

2. “Articles” means the cooperative’s articles of association.

3. “Authorized person” means a person who is one of the following:

a. A farming entity.

b. A person who owns at least one hundred fifty acres of agricultural land and receives as rent a share of the crops or the animals raised on the land if that person is a natural person or a general partnership as organized under chapter 486, Code 1999, or chapter 486A in which all partners are natural persons.

c. An employee of the cooperative who performs at least one thousand hours of service for the cooperative in each calendar year.

4. “Board” means the cooperative’s board of directors.

5. “Cooperative” means a cooperative association organized under this chapter or converted to this chapter pursuant to section 501.601.

6. “Farming” means the same as defined in section 9H.1.

7. “Farming entity” means any one of the following:

a. A natural person or a fiduciary for a natural person who regularly participates in physical labor or operations management in a farming operation and files schedule F as part of the person’s annual form 1040 or form 1041 filing with the United States internal revenue service.

b. A family farm corporation, family farm limited liability company, family farm limited partnership, or family trust, as defined in section 9H.1.

c. A general partnership as organized under chapter 486, Code 1999, or chapter 486A in which all the partners are natural persons actively engaged in farming as provided in section 9H.1.

8. “Interest” means a voting interest or other interest in a cooperative as described in the cooperative’s articles of association.

9. “Interest holder” means a person who owns an interest in a cooperative, whether or not that interest has voting rights.

10. “Member” means a person who owns a voting interest in a cooperative.

11. “Membership” means the interest established by a member owning a voting interest.

12. “Voting interest” means an interest in a cooperative that has voting rights.
